WebIn general, epigenetics refers to heritable changes in gene expression that are, unlike mutations, not attributable to alterations in the sequence of the DNA [ 4 ]. Among the epigenetic events are: DNA and histone modifications, ATP-dependent chromatin remodeling complexes and non-coding RNAs [ 5, 6, 7, 8 ].
